Using the latest LHCb measurements of time-dependent CP violation in the B0 s → K + K − decay, a U-spin relation between the decay amplitudes of B0 s → K + K − and B0 → π+π− decay processes allows constraints to be placed on the angle γ of the unitarity triangle and on the B0 s mixing phase −2βs . Results from an extended approach, which uses additional inputs on B0 → π0π0 and B+ → π+π0 decays from other experiments and exploits isospin symmetry, are also presented. The dependence of the results on the maximum allowed amount of U-spin breaking is studied. At 68% probability, the value γ = (63.5+7.2 −6.7)◦ modulo 180◦ is determined. In an alternative analysis, the value −2βs = −0.12+0.14 −0.16 rad is found. In both measurements, the uncertainties due to U-spin breaking effects up to 50% are included.
